## llms.txt Support
Skill_Seekers automatically detects llms.txt files before HTML scraping:
### Detection Order
1. `{base_url}/llms-full.txt` (complete documentation)
2. `{base_url}/llms.txt` (standard version)
3. `{base_url}/llms-small.txt` (quick reference)
### Benefits
- ⚡ 10x faster (< 5 seconds vs 20-60 seconds)
- ✅ More reliable (maintained by docs authors)
- 🎯 Better quality (pre-formatted for LLMs)
- 🚫 No rate limiting needed
### Example Sites
- Hono: https://hono.dev/llms-full.txt
If no llms.txt is found, automatically falls back to HTML scraping.

# llms.txt Support
## Overview
Skill_Seekers now automatically detects and uses llms.txt files when available, providing 10x faster documentation ingestion.
## What is llms.txt?
The llms.txt convention is a growing standard where documentation sites provide pre-formatted, LLM-ready markdown files:
- `llms-full.txt` - Complete documentation
- `llms.txt` - Standard balanced version
- `llms-small.txt` - Quick reference
## How It Works
1. Before HTML scraping, Skill_Seekers checks for llms.txt files
2. If found, downloads and parses the markdown
3. If not found, falls back to HTML scraping
4. Zero config changes needed
## Configuration
### Automatic Detection (Recommended)
No config changes needed. Just run normally:
```bash
python3 cli/doc_scraper.py --config configs/hono.json
```
### Explicit URL
Optionally specify llms.txt URL:
```json
{
"name": "hono",
"llms_txt_url": "https://hono.dev/llms-full.txt",
"base_url": "https://hono.dev/docs"
}
```
## Performance Comparison
| Method | Time | Requests |
|--------|------|----------|
| HTML Scraping (20 pages) | 20-60s | 20+ |
| llms.txt | < 5s | 1 |
## Supported Sites
Sites known to provide llms.txt:
- Hono: https://hono.dev/llms-full.txt
- (More to be discovered)
## Fallback Behavior
If llms.txt download or parsing fails, automatically falls back to HTML scraping with no user intervention required.

# Active Skills Design - Demand-Driven Documentation Loading
**Date:** 2025-10-24
**Type:** Architecture Design
**Status:** Phase 1 Implemented ✅
**Author:** Edgar + Claude (Brainstorming Session)
---
## Executive Summary
Transform Skill_Seekers from creating **passive documentation dumps** into **active, intelligent skills** that load documentation on-demand. This eliminates context bloat (300k → 5-10k per query) while maintaining full access to complete documentation.
**Key Innovation:** Skills become lightweight routers with heavy tools in `scripts/`, not documentation repositories.
---
## Problem Statement
### Current Architecture: Passive Skills
**What happens today:**
```
Agent: "How do I use Hono middleware?"
Skill: *Claude loads 203k llms-txt.md into context*
Agent: *answers using loaded docs*
Result: Context bloat, slower performance, hits limits
```
**Issues:**
1. **Context Bloat**: 319k llms-full.txt loaded entirely into context
2. **Wasted Resources**: Agent needs 5k but gets 319k
3. **Truncation Loss**: 36% of content lost (319k → 203k) due to size limits
4. **File Extension Bug**: llms.txt files stored as .txt instead of .md
5. **Single Variant**: Only downloads one file (usually llms-full.txt)
### Current File Structure
```
output/hono/
├── SKILL.md ──────────► Documentation dump + instructions
├── references/
│ └── llms-txt.md ───► 203k (36% truncated from 319k original)
├── scripts/ ──────────► EMPTY (placeholder only!)
└── assets/ ───────────► EMPTY (placeholder only!)
```
---
## Proposed Architecture: Active Skills
### Core Concept
**Skills = Routers + Tools**, not documentation dumps.
**New workflow:**
```
Agent: "How do I use Hono middleware?"
Skill: *runs scripts/search.py "middleware"*
Script: *loads llms-full.md, extracts middleware section, returns 8k*
Agent: *answers using ONLY 8k* (CLEAN CONTEXT!)
Result: 40x less context, no truncation, full access to docs
```
### Benefits
| Metric | Before | After | Improvement |
|--------|--------|-------|-------------|
| Context per query | 203k | 5-10k | **20-40x reduction** |
| Content loss | 36% truncated | 0% (no truncation) | **Full fidelity** |
| Variants available | 1 | 3 | **User choice** |
| File format | .txt (wrong) | .md (correct) | **Fixed** |
| Agent workflow | Passive read | Active tools | **Autonomous** |
